Output d3ca16ff64edafaaf4e21fc402d65a72eb962162d8708dcffd27e77afaddfc41:1

value
1020899
script pubkey
OP_0 OP_PUSHBYTES_32 1d132b926109cb97c690fd27dbc4b214e01e961e34d1a021670af88a6fda9be4
address
bc1qr5fjhynpp89e035sl5nah39jznspa9s7xng6qgt8ptug5m76n0jqax6874
transaction
d3ca16ff64edafaaf4e21fc402d65a72eb962162d8708dcffd27e77afaddfc41
confirmations
180802
spent
true